Output 574096de8e35c0b0467a0fba799f1ec558bb2b1a6b9ccd149fb45bc14a6b3d07:31

value
628064
script pubkey
OP_0 OP_PUSHBYTES_20 97c68e00da4e212c5b3b9709fb6eef538bf1f24a
address
bc1qjlrguqx6fcsjckemjuylkmh02w9lruj2jdqn8l
transaction
574096de8e35c0b0467a0fba799f1ec558bb2b1a6b9ccd149fb45bc14a6b3d07
confirmations
149382
spent
true